How to Cook Rainbow Tortellini?

Cooking Rainbow Tortellini is easy and straightforward. Simply follow these steps: - Boil 6-8 cups of water in a large pot, adding salt if desired. - Add the tortellini to the boiling water and cook for 8-10 minutes, or until fully cooked. You can test it by removing a piece and cutting it in half. If it's cooked, the filling should be hot and the pasta should be tender.

How to Store Rainbow Tortellini?

To store Rainbow Tortellini, keep it in an airtight container or resealable bag in the refrigerator. It can last up to 5 days. If you want to freeze it, place the tortellini in a single layer on a baking sheet and freeze until solid. Then, transfer the frozen tortellini to a freezer-safe container and store it for up to 2 months.

Nutritional Values of 1 cup (100 g) Rainbow Tortellini

UnitValue
Calories (kcal)280 kcal
Fat (g)6 g
Carbs (g)41 g
Protein (g)12 g

Calorie breakdown: 20% fat, 62% carbs, 18% protein
